RIDER PROFILE: Jacob S. Hacker    
DOB: 1/3/71  
Birthplace: Eugene, Oregon  
Hometown: New Haven (until I come up for tenure, at least)  
Bike(s):Trek 5500  
Student status at Yale: Professor  
Year(s) with cycling team: Raced for Yale in 1998 and 1999  
Previous racing/athletic experience: Raced from 1987 to 1991 and from 1997 to 2000; Category 1; rode for U.S. national team in Europe, 1989; three-time collegiate national champion (omnium 1990, road and omnium 1998).  
Biographical sketch: An assistant professor of political science, I try to join the team for weekend rides, that is, when my wife, Oona (who is a professor at the Law School) and my two children -- Ava, 3, and my newborn son Owen -- let me. I have significant racing experience and some coaching experience, so feel free to throw questions my way.
